We've reached that level i've spoken of earlier (right around the HVN of the year). If prices can hold under the yearly VWAP and last months POC (Black box on TPO chart), we could see a flush under to the DVAL of the year. Conversely this could be a potential swing low if prices can hold above that zone (TPO chart)..
FOMC release in a few min, things will be a little haywire, lets see where we come out of this and if the news will alter anything..
*weak release, no surprises, real quiet, fed isnt doing anything before elections. Yield trend likely to continue higher*
You must be looking at a different time period for the "Year",
I assume you mean for the last 12 months, not just the 2016 calendar year?
I ask because I have the HVN for 2016 [308 days] at 165'23 using a chart based on a "daily" timeframe of 1440 minutes, VAL at 161'01 VAH at 170'15
VWAP at 166'01
